Gypsy Rose Blanchard recently shared via Instagram that she will not post pictures of her newborn daughter, Aurora

Gypsy Rose Blanchard, the 33-year-old mother, recently shared an update on Instagram regarding her newborn daughter, Aurora Urker. In a post on January 6, Blanchard addressed the overwhelming public interest in her baby’s pictures, stating that she would not be sharing any photos of Aurora on social media to protect her privacy and safety. She thanked her supporters for their excitement and continued support but emphasized the importance of respecting her daughter’s privacy.

Aurora was born on December 28, 2023, the same day Blanchard was released from prison after serving time for the 2015 murder of her mother, Dee Blanchard. The news of Aurora’s birth was first shared by Blanchard’s boyfriend, Ken Urker, who posted a photo of the family in the hospital on New Year’s Day.

Blanchard’s mother, Dee Blanchard, suffered from Munchausen by proxy syndrome, subjecting her daughter to unnecessary medical treatments and ultimately orchestrating her own death. Gypsy Rose Blanchard had previously shared her pregnancy news in July 2023 on YouTube. During an interview with Good Morning America, she expressed her hopes to give her daughter the experiences and milestones that were deprived of her by her mother.

In a 2024 interview with People, Blanchard revealed that she and Urker had named their daughter Aurora after their shared fascination with the northern lights, also known as the Aurora Borealis.
